AI Technical Summary
Existing automotive sheet metal welding strength testing devices are insufficient in terms of effectiveness and flexibility, making it difficult to effectively detect differences in weld strength and generate convenient test records.
A welding strength testing device for automotive sheet metal parts, including a detection component and an adjustment pressing component, was designed. The welding strength is judged by setting color-coded blocks and an inner spring, and stable detection is achieved by using a drive motor and a screw, forming a paper test record.
It enables convenient welding strength testing and flexible test position adjustment, and can determine the strength level based on the color of the stop block, forming paper records for easy quality traceability and analysis.

Claims
1. An automobile sheet metal part welding strength testing device, comprising a base (1), characterized in that: A side support frame (2) is provided on the top right side of the base (1), an adjustment and pressing component (3) is provided on the left side of the side support frame (2), and a detection component (4) is provided on the right side of the side support frame (2). The detection assembly (4) includes a support plate (401), a detection placement plate (402), a pressing plate (403), a color-coded stop (404), an inner spring (405), a connecting rectangular plate (406), and mounting bolts (407). The support plate (401) is fixedly connected to the right side of the left-side side support frame (2) near the top. 3. The device for testing the welding strength of an automobile sheet metal part according to claim 2, characterized in that: A bearing component is fixedly connected to the left side of the inner top of the limiting U-shaped frame (306), and the inner ring of the bearing component is fixedly connected to the top of the screw (312).
4. The device for testing the welding strength of an automobile sheet metal part according to claim 1, characterized in that: The number of sets of the pressed plate (403), the color marking block (404) and the inner spring (405) are all three, and the thickness of the three sets of color marking blocks (404) decreases from left to right.
5. The welding strength testing device for automotive sheet metal parts according to claim 1, characterized in that: The color of the color indicator block (404) on the left is green, the color of the color indicator block (404) in the middle is yellow, and the color of the color indicator block (404) on the right is red.
6. The device for testing the welding strength of an automobile sheet metal part according to claim 1, characterized in that: The connecting rectangular plate (406) has a threaded groove inside, and the top of the detection placement plate (402) has a connecting screw hole with the same diameter as the threaded groove.
7. The device for testing the welding strength of an automobile sheet metal part according to claim 2, characterized in that: The top of the first slide (301) is provided with a slide groove, and the bottom of the second slide (304) is fixedly connected with a slider. The thickness of the slider is adapted to the thickness of the slide groove. The second slide (304) is slidably connected to the top of the first slide (301).
